Detailed explanation-1: -Band 1 Visible Blue (0.45-0.52 µm) 30 m. Band 2 Visible Green (0.52-0.60 µm) 30 m. Band 3 Visible Red (0.63-0.69 µm) 30 m. Band 4 Near-Infrared (0.76-0.90 µm) 30 m.

Detailed explanation-2: -Landsat 1-5 Multispectral Scanner (MSS) images consist of four spectral bands with 60 meter spatial resolution. Approximate scene size is 170 km north-south by 185 km east-west (106 mi by 115 mi).

Detailed explanation-3: -Landsat-5 was launched on 1 March 1984 from the same launch site, and the mission ended on 5 June 2013.
